The National Security Sector at Leidos is hiring for a Expert Graphic Designer to join our team supporting a U.S. federal government intelligence agency. This role involves working closely with analysts to understand their requirements and using your graphic design skills to enhance and convey analytic thoughts and assessments. The ideal candidate will have a passion for geographic information systems and a knack for turning complex information into compelling visual stories. This position is contingent upon contract award.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Use technology to design and develop a wide range of intelligence products, integrating graphics with text, audio, and video to support interactive and multimedia high-visibility finished intelligence products.
  • Produce dynamic content in accordance with Intelligence Community (IC) published standards, including podcasts and audio segments.
  • Mentor junior designers, providing technical guidance and support.

What does Leidos need from me?

  • Must have an active Top Secret security clearance with the ability to obtain and maintain a TS/SCI with Polygraph.
  • Minimum 20 years of experience in graphic design with at least a portion of the experience within the last two years.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in professional graphics and design software to include, but not limited to: Adobe Creative Su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ator, After Effects, Premiere, and Flash), Apple Final Cut Pro X, and Apple Mac hardware platforms, Map Publisher, Microsoft 365, and any other interactive graphics enablers, languages, or tools specified.
  • Experience in applying IC and DoD classification guidelines and procedures.
  • Demonstrated ability to provide graphic design expertise to junior graphic designers.
  • Experience using logic when evaluating and synthesizing multiple sources of information.
  • Experience producing timely, logical, and concise graphics.
  • Experience communicating complex issues clearly in a concise and organized manner both verbally and non-verbally; with strong grammar skills.
  • Experience researching and obtaining, evaluating, organizing, and maintaining information within security and data protocols.
  • Experience recognizing nuances and resolve contradictions and inconsistencies in information.
  • Understanding of complex analytic methodologies, such as structured analytic techniques or alternative approaches, to examine biases, assumptions, and theories to eliminate uncertainty, strengthen analytic arguments, and mitigate surprise.

Favorable if you have:

  • Experience with HTML, Cascading Style Sheets (CSS), Java Script, d3.js, leaflet.js, Angular, or Typescript.
  • Experience in Business Analytics.  
  • In-depth knowledge and demonstrable experience with the intelligence production cycle, executive intelligence production, graphic design, web development, and data science and related technologies.
  • Experience defining problems, supervising studies and leading surveys to collect and analyze data to provide advice and recommend solutions.  
  • Master’s degree in an area related to the labor category from a college or university accredited by an ag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education.
